Nintendo Switch 2: Everything we know about the coming release
Nintendo Switch 2: Everything we know about the coming release
今回、不倫で有名になった乙武さんの謝罪文はAWSのS3で構築してる。技術的にもプロの犯行だ。S3とは、ざっくり言うとAmazonさんが運営してるほぼ絶対落ちない静的サーバのことです。http://ototake.com をDNSで全部S3に降ってる。要するに謝罪文しか表示しないけど絶対落ちないサーバをAmazonさんから短期的に借りる。今後、芸能人の謝罪文はAWSのS3というソリューションが増える。 GMOさんは芸能人に強いのに営業しないのかな。CAと組んで謝罪文サーバとか売ればいいのに。これは、芸能人のサイトを運用している人には重要な事例だ。教科書にのるかもしれない。むしろ、今後の謝罪ページのセオリーになるかもしれない。昔に比べて、DNSの浸透は爆速になったので、こういうのが可能なんだろな。 今まで、ototake.comを無視して、短期的にS3にDNSを降ることで、以下のメリットが有る
Eureka EngineeringLearn about Eureka’s engineering efforts, product developments and more.
japan.zdnet.com JS界隈が大騒ぎになった事件だけど、こういった事件自体は完全に防ぐことは不可能だと思う。 今回は依存ライブラリが削除されるだけで済んだけど、 npm install するだけで ~/.ssh ディレクトリを zip にしてどこかに送信するような悪質な攻撃であれば、単にCIが止まるどころでなく、世界中のエンジニアの秘密鍵がばらまかれてあちこちのサーバーにssh可能な事態になったわけで、そんな悪質な攻撃を bugfix なマイクロバージョンアップとして公開される事もありえたわけだ。 第三者のパッケージに依存するということは、それだけのリスクを背負い込むということだ。だが、逆に外部のライブラリに依存しないようにすると、生産性が落ちてしまう。 なので、コードを読む、信頼できるメンテナの公開しているパッケージを選ぶなどといった方法で、リスクとメリットのバランスを取って
npmとは、node.jsにおけるパッケージシステムのことだ。npmを使えば、他人の書いたnode.jsベースのプログラムとライブラリの入手と利用がとても簡単になる。 そのnpm界隈が混乱している。発端は以下のURLだ。 I’ve Just Liberated My Modules — Medium Azer Koçuluはkikという名前のnpmパッケージを公開していた。このkikというソフトウェアの中身についてはここでは関係がない。 さて、それとは別に、kik.comというスマフォ用のチャットアプリを出しているKik Interactive社がいて、kikという名前のパッケージをnpmで出したいので、名前を明け渡すように要求した。 Azerはこの要求を拒否した。すると、Kik Interactive社はnpmの管理者に片っ端からメールを投げまくり、そのうちの一人が反応して、Azerの意
【自分用メモ】関東ITソフトウェア厚生年金基金の解散後の対応について 2016-03-01-2 [Money] 自分用メモです。 または関係者向け。 案内書類より引用したり抜粋したり。 関東ITソフトウェア厚生年金基金は平成28(2016)年7月に解散予定加入期間が10年以上か否かで金額に大きな差が出る加入員の平均年齢38歳・平均加入期間8年と「若者の短期加入」が多い不公平感あり!解散!なるべく公平にした分配金を支給し関東ITソフトウェア厚生年金基金は終了厚生年金基金は「国の代行部分」と「独自の上乗せ部分」からなる 代行部分は国へ返上(後で国から年金が支給される)基金独自の上乗せ部分を清算(今回)→分配金選択肢1: 第1年金(確定給付企業年金)に持っていく(将来の年金)選択肢2a: 一時金として受け取る選択肢2b: 企業年金連合会へ持っていく(将来の年金)図:第1年金 の支給形態イメージ
Java 6 以前でのテキストファイル読み込み Java 6 以前で面倒だったのは主に以下の2点。 try ブロックの外で変数を宣言しておかないと、finally でリソース開放処理ができない リソース解放するための close メソッドで例外が出たときのことを考慮しないといけない サンプルコード。 import java.io.BufferedReader; import java.io.FileReader; import java.io.IOException; public class Cat{ public static void main(String[] args){ String filePath = args[0]; // try ブロックの外で変数を宣言しておかないと、 // finally でリソース開放処理ができない FileReader fr = null; Bu
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く